10 Health Benefits Of Alligator Pepper

Alligator Pepper Health Benefits

Alligator pepper (Aframomum melegueta) is a popular West African spice and is highly valuable as a result of its health benefits.

Its other names are hepper pepper, mbongo spice, Afrika kakulesi, melegueta pepper, ginny papper, Guinea pepper, or atare in Yorubaland.

The skin of the fruit has a close similarity with the back of an alligator, hence the origin of its name. The fruit contains many small brownish seeds with a sharp, peppery, bitter, pungent, and aromatic flavor.

Apart from medicinal purposes, alligator pepper is a great addition for culinary purposes and is commonly used as a pepper soup ingredient.

In the Yoruba and Igbo cultures of Nigeria, alligator pepper is a common part of ceremonies and social events, e.g., naming ceremonies.
